Whatever raid metadata was written by WinXP-64 was destroyed and I was able to do a proper install of CentOS 6.
I'd still strongly recommend, if you haven't done so, check your BIOS to make sure your SATA controller doesn't have RAID mode enabled. I've seen the odd weird interaction between Linux, the BIOS, and the SATA controller (especially early non-"Intel ICH" family) that was traced back to that setting.
